Property Overview: 71 Clovercrest Bay, Bridgwater Forest
Key Characteristics & Appeal
This two-storey home in the popular Bridgwater Forest neighbourhood offers a modern, low-maintenance lifestyle. Built in 2010, it sits on a standard lot but stands out with its generous 2,477 sqft of living space, which is notably larger than most comparable homes in the area. A key feature is its renovated basement, adding valuable finished space. The home includes an attached garage and has demonstrated strong, steady appreciation in value over recent years.
Its primary appeal lies in its balance of space, modernity, and location. It suits buyers looking for a move-in ready, spacious family home in a well-established newer community without the premium of a brand-new build. The consistent increase in sale price suggests a well-maintained property in a stable area. It would particularly suit growing families or professionals who value efficient use of interior space over a large yard, and savvy buyers who appreciate a home with recent updates (like the basement) that has already proven to be a sound investment based on its sales history.
Frequently Asked Questions
1. How does the lot size compare to the neighbourhood?
The land area is 4,224 sqft, which is fairly standard for the street and neighbourhood. The home’s standout feature is its above-average interior living space, making it an efficient choice for those prioritizing indoor square footage over extensive outdoor land.
2. What does the sales history indicate about the property’s value?
The home has sold three times since 2020, each time at a higher price point ($54.1k in 2020, $66.5k in 2021, $69.7k in 2025). This pattern indicates consistent market demand and steady appreciation, suggesting the property has been well-maintained and is in a desirable location.
3. Is the assessed value in line with recent sale prices?
The current assessed value is $65.60k. The 2025 sale price of $69.70k is reasonably close, indicating the assessment is relatively current and the market value is likely stable around or slightly above that figure.
4. How does this home rank for space within Winnipeg?
With 2,477 sqft of living area, this home ranks in the top 3% of all Winnipeg properties for interior space. This is its most statistically notable feature, offering significantly more room than the vast majority of homes in the city.
5. What is the neighbourhood ranking based on?
The rankings provided compare this specific property to others on its street, in Bridgwater Forest, and across Winnipeg for metrics like living area, assessed value, and year built. For example, it ranks in the top 13% on its street for living area, meaning it is among the largest homes on Clovercrest Bay.
